The DJ version, Carey And Lloyds, Come Down is a wonderful slice of Alcaponeesq vocal squeeks and yelps, and was released on the Grape record label also in 1972. Carey Johnson started off releasing a handful of cuts for Coxsone Dodd in the latter 1960 s, including Musical Scorcher and More Scorcher. Lloyd Young seems to be the baby of the duo, having started his career off in 1972 for Prince Tony and Winston Riley.
